Showing
4 changed files
with
48 additions
and
0 deletions
@@ -8183,6 +8183,7 @@ require("js/me/personal-details"); | @@ -8183,6 +8183,7 @@ require("js/me/personal-details"); | ||
8183 | require("js/me/currency"); | 8183 | require("js/me/currency"); |
8184 | require("js/me/currency-new"); | 8184 | require("js/me/currency-new"); |
8185 | require("js/me/message"); | 8185 | require("js/me/message"); |
8186 | +require("js/me/message-detail"); | ||
8186 | 8187 | ||
8187 | }); | 8188 | }); |
8188 | define("js/me/order", ["jquery","hammer","lazyload","handlebars","source-map"], function(require, exports, module){ | 8189 | define("js/me/order", ["jquery","hammer","lazyload","handlebars","source-map"], function(require, exports, module){ |
@@ -10778,6 +10779,52 @@ $page.on('touchstart', '.del', function() { | @@ -10778,6 +10779,52 @@ $page.on('touchstart', '.del', function() { | ||
10778 | massageAJAX(page); | 10779 | massageAJAX(page); |
10779 | 10780 | ||
10780 | }); | 10781 | }); |
10782 | +define("js/me/message-detail", ["jquery","handlebars","source-map","hammer"], function(require, exports, module){ | ||
10783 | +var $ = require("jquery"), | ||
10784 | + dialog = require("js/me/dialog"); | ||
10785 | + | ||
10786 | +var $page = $('.massage-page'); | ||
10787 | + | ||
10788 | +var pickBusy = false; | ||
10789 | + | ||
10790 | + | ||
10791 | +// 领取生日券 | ||
10792 | +$page.on('touchstart', '.pick-coupon-btn', function() { | ||
10793 | + if (pickBusy) { | ||
10794 | + return; | ||
10795 | + } | ||
10796 | + pickBusy = true; | ||
10797 | + | ||
10798 | + var $id = $(this).data('id'); | ||
10799 | + | ||
10800 | + $.ajax({ | ||
10801 | + type: 'POST', | ||
10802 | + url: '/home/pickCoupon', | ||
10803 | + data: { | ||
10804 | + id: $id | ||
10805 | + }, | ||
10806 | + success: function(data) { | ||
10807 | + if (data.code === 200) { | ||
10808 | + dialog.showDialog({ | ||
10809 | + dialogText: '领取成功', | ||
10810 | + autoHide: 2000, | ||
10811 | + fast: true | ||
10812 | + }); | ||
10813 | + $(this).removeClass('pick-coupon-btn'); | ||
10814 | + } | ||
10815 | + | ||
10816 | + pickBusy = false; | ||
10817 | + | ||
10818 | + dialog.showDialog({ | ||
10819 | + dialogText: data.message, | ||
10820 | + autoHide: 2000, | ||
10821 | + fast: true | ||
10822 | + }); | ||
10823 | + } | ||
10824 | + }); | ||
10825 | +}); | ||
10826 | + | ||
10827 | +}); | ||
10781 | define("js/cart/entry", ["jquery","mlellipsis","hammer","handlebars","source-map","swiper","lazyload","index"], function(require, exports, module){ | 10828 | define("js/cart/entry", ["jquery","mlellipsis","hammer","handlebars","source-map","swiper","lazyload","index"], function(require, exports, module){ |
10782 | /** | 10829 | /** |
10783 | * 购物车打包入口 | 10830 | * 购物车打包入口 |
This diff could not be displayed because it is too large.
This diff could not be displayed because it is too large.
-
Please register or login to post a comment